When I add a word attachment to an outgoing message I can not open it to check but I can open after I have sent the message

I have recently changed computers and have loaded the latest version of Thunderbird last update 45.7.0 previously there was no problem.

Strange.

Try this. Thunderbird menu: Tools: Options: Attachments section: Incoming tab (If you cannot see the Thunderbird menu, press the Alt key or F10 key on your keyboard to show the menu) See my screenshot below.

Remove any entries for Word & Excel documents (select, then press delete button on the keyboard). Then click the OK button.

Quit Thunderbird, then restart it.

Immediately start a new e-mail and attach a Word or Excel file, then double-click it. It should ask you what program to use to open the file. Choose the appropriate one.
